NorthStar Medical Radioisotopes Receives Electron Beam Accelerators for First-of-its-Kind Advanced Medical Radioisotope Production.
 NorthStar, leading the way as the sole U.S. commercial supplier of molybdenum-99 (Mo-99), continues expansion efforts for increased capacity and ongoing reliable supply for diagnostic imaging −
BELOIT, Wis.–(BUSINESS WIRE), 12 May 21, NorthStar Medical Radioisotopes, LLC, a global innovator in the development, production and commercialization of radiopharmaceuticals used for medical imaging and therapeutic applications, announced that it has achieved a major milestone in its efforts to expand U.S. production capacity for the important medical radioisotope, molybdenum-99 (Mo-99). The Company has received two custom-built IBA Rhodotron®TT 300-HE (High Energy) electron beam accelerators at its facility in Beloit, Wisconsin. First-of-its-kind technology: Particle accelerators installed in Beloit's NorthStar


BELOIT (WREX) A particle accelerator sounds like something out of a Sci-Fi movie but there are two of them in the Stateline, and two firsts for the United States.
Two customized, 24-ton electron beam particle accelerators were hoisted by crane and installed into NorthStar’s new Accelerator Production facility in Beloit.
The equipment will be a more sustainable option for more than 40,000 medical imaging processes per day, according to NorthStar.
The particle accelerators run at .999 percent the speed of light, making a the medical radioisotope molybdenum-99 (Mo-99) more sustainable than its predecessor, the parent radioisotope of technetium-99m.
